I made a deliciously healthy (and hearty) Apple Pie Oatmeal. Like the flavored oatmeal packets that are available in grocery stores, my recipe is equally as quick without all the added sugar. And, its inviting scent of apple and cloves is sure to get you into the holiday spirit.

Apple Pie Oatmeal

  • 1/2 cup steel-cut oatmeal
  • 2 cups of water
  • One apple cut into tiny slices (I prefer Fuji)
  • 2 tbs Cinnamon
  • 1 tbs Ground Cloves
  • 2 tbs Local Honey
  • 2 tbs Sorghum (optional)
Directions

Combine all the ingredients into a pan and set to medium, cook until boiling. It shouldn't take over ten minutes. Then voila! You have the perfect start to your morning.
